συμφανής

Third declension Adjective; Transliteration:

Principal Part: συμφανής συμφανές

Structure: συμφανη (Stem) + ς (Ending)

Etym.: fanh=nai

Sense

  1. manifest at the same time, quite manifest

Examples

  • τὸ μὲν διὰ βιαίων καὶ συμφανῶν πράξεων πραττόμενον ἑκάστοτε, τὸ δὲ μετὰ σκότουσ καὶ ἀπάτησ λαθραίωσ γιγνόμενον, ἔστιν δ’ ὅτε καὶ δι’ ἀμφοῖν τούτοιν πραχθέν· (Plato, Laws, book 9 71:3)
